List at least four of the most important guidelines for dealing with the media
What will be an ideal response?
1. A reporter is a reporter.
2. You are the organization.
3. There is no standard-issue reporter.
4. Treat journalists professionally.
5. Don't sweat the skepticism.
6. Don't try to "buy" a journalist.
7. Become a trusted source.
8. Talk when not "selling."
9. Don't expect "news" agreement.
10. Don't cop an attitude.
11. Never lie. This is the cardinal rule.
12. Read the paper.
